如何阻止 WordPress 中的联系表单垃圾邮件
已发表: 2024-11-27
从收件箱中的联系表单垃圾邮件中找出真正的联系表单条目非常累人。黑客和机器人如此之多,人们总是担心您的表单中会出现垃圾邮件条目。好吧,不再是了。在这里,我们提供了有关如何阻止网站联系表单中的垃圾邮件并仅获取重要查询的详细指南。
别担心,我们将为您提供多种选择,供您选择可行的一种。但这样做真的那么重要吗?你就不能自己查一下然后整理一下吗?好吧,当然,如果您有足够的时间来经营您的业务。但除了节省时间之外,还必须考虑其他几点。
节省服务器空间:垃圾邮件提交将利用您服务器上的空间、带宽和处理能力。这会影响您的网站并减慢速度,而且服务器空间不是免费的!
防止数据过载:您不希望数据库太快被填满。过多的垃圾邮件会使您的数据库超载,从而随着时间的推移增加成本。
改进的电子邮件响应:当您手动整理垃圾邮件时,对合法查询的响应时间可能会增加。这会对您的业务产生不利影响。但如果它已经排序,您的响应时间就会很快。
防范恶意软件:提交的垃圾邮件可能带有有害链接或文件附件,可能会影响您网站的安全。它还可以窃取您用户的数据。因此,需要垃圾邮件防护。
维护信任和安全:受垃圾邮件保护的表单让用户在填写时感到安全。此外,他们会知道他们的询问将得到认真对待并得到答复。
减少管理负担:手动筛选条目需要花费大量工时。您可能只需要雇用专门的人员来完成这项任务。
现在您已经了解了防止联系表单垃圾邮件的重要性,让我们看看实现它的各种方法。
当涉及 WordPress 网站管理的任何方面时,WordPress 插件都是全能解决方案。使用反垃圾邮件插件是保存联系表单的最简单也是最有效的方法之一。这些插件经过训练可以过滤常见模式以阻止垃圾邮件源。现在,这些插件会定期更新,以了解新的垃圾邮件技术并防止它们。
Akismet、Antispam Bee、WPBruiser 和 Spam Destroyer 等插件非常流行,可以从 WordPress.org 免费下载。这些插件是轻量级的,可以有效地阻止垃圾邮件。
这些插件易于设置,无需任何编码知识即可配置。这是在没有验证码的情况下防止联系表单垃圾邮件的理想方法。
我们所有人都多次遇到过 Google reCAPTCHA 和“确认您是人类”。同样,您可以为 WordPress 启用 reCAPTCHA。通常,它会给识别图像或选中复选框带来挑战。该算法经过相应的训练,可以理解并防止机器人向您的网站提交联系表单垃圾邮件。
目前,reCAPTCHA 有两个主要版本。它们是 reCAPTCHA v2 和 v3。
v2版本为用户提供了选择特定图像的任务。它们的设计方式使得机器人无法轻易绕过。
v3 是一个不可见的 reCAPTCHA 版本。图像或复选框对某些人来说可能看起来很突兀,这就是 V3 的原因。它在后台运行并跟踪用户行为。由此,它可以确定它是机器人还是人类。
将 Google reCAPTCHA 与您的 WordPress 网站集成起来相当容易。借助 ARForms,您可以启用 reCAPTCHA 以实现动态表单安全。
蜜罐技术是添加垃圾邮件防护的最令人印象深刻的方法之一。这是一种用户友好的方法,不会中断用户与表单的交互。您可以使用 CSS 或 HTML 手动设置,或使用提供蜜罐反垃圾邮件功能的插件。但它实际上是如何运作的呢?
手动实现代码
创建隐藏字段:
对于设置举报垃圾邮件的条件(如果满足):
此方法还提供无形的垃圾邮件防护并增加了一层安全性。每个填写表单的真实用户都会获得一个唯一的一次性令牌。该令牌由 JavaScript 生成。该令牌是提交表单所必需的。现在,机器人不具备 JavaScript 功能,因此无法生成这些令牌。没有令牌,没有表单提交。
通过这种方法,用户体验不会受到任何影响。这是与其他一些垃圾邮件防护方法的强大补充方法。因此,您可以轻松地设置分层安全。
唯一的缺点是技术设置。如果您是编码员或开发人员,那么这很容易。但对于其他人来说,这可能是一件令人头疼的事情。但是,如果您有技术支持,则必须考虑它是一个可靠的安全层。
WordPress 防火墙甚至可以在垃圾邮件到达您的网站之前就成为强大的 WordPress 垃圾邮件拦截器。他们接受过培训,可以监控所有流量并阻止所有可疑行为模式。 Wordfence、Defender Pro、Sucuri 和 BulletProof 是著名的防火墙插件。这些插件足够先进,可以阻止垃圾邮件并保护您的网站免受黑客攻击。它还可以保护您免受恶意软件或任何 DDoS 攻击。
防火墙足够强大,可以阻止可疑的 IP 地址、国家或具有类似垃圾邮件行为的用户。这在服务器级别起作用,因此机器人甚至无法到达您的表单。
多个 WordPress 安全插件提供垃圾邮件防护、防火墙、恶意软件和黑客防护等功能。其中最著名的是 Jetpack、Wordfence Security 和 Security Optimizer。
借助 ARForms,您可以获得内置的反垃圾邮件和 reCAPTCHA 支持。因此,在构建多种形式的同时,您还可以关注安全性。您不需要 Google reCAPTCHA 或任何其他带有 ARForms 的外部插件。
此外,您还可以获得带有 ARForms 的 Google reCAPTCHA 免费附加组件,以保护您的网站免受垃圾邮件和滥用行为的侵害。它具有简单的界面并提供跨浏览器支持。它的过程非常简单,您需要添加 API 密钥来激活它。
借助 ARForms,您可以获得 Google reCAPTCHA 和 Cloudflare Turnstile CAPTCHA 的内置功能。避免使用多个插件来处理垃圾邮件和安全问题,并从单个插件中获取解决方案。
阻止联系表单垃圾邮件的方法多种多样。您可以选择一种或使用多种方法设置多步骤安全性。如果您经常创建多个表单,那么选择 ARForms 反垃圾邮件插件是最佳选择。它将为您提供强大的功能,如条件逻辑、数学逻辑、内置模板、地图集成、在线支付等等!它是一个全能的表单插件,具有免费的精简版本,具有强大的反垃圾邮件功能。
您准备好保护您的表单免受机器人攻击并提高您的效率了吗?选择一种方法,让我们的读者知道哪种方法最适合您。
另请阅读这些:
别担心,我们将为您提供多种选择,供您选择可行的一种。但这样做真的那么重要吗?你就不能自己查一下然后整理一下吗?好吧,当然,如果您有足够的时间来经营您的业务。但除了节省时间之外,还必须考虑其他几点。
阻止联系表垃圾邮件的重要性
那么,谁的办公桌更整齐呢?肯定是艾米·圣地亚哥的。您可以快速找到东西并感觉井井有条。专注于重要的事情。而杰克,嗯,要找到东西会很困难。你可以因为房间里的杂乱而成为杰克团队,但不能因为联系表格而成为杰克团队。为什么?让我们开始吧。节省服务器空间:垃圾邮件提交将利用您服务器上的空间、带宽和处理能力。这会影响您的网站并减慢速度,而且服务器空间不是免费的!
防止数据过载:您不希望数据库太快被填满。过多的垃圾邮件会使您的数据库超载,从而随着时间的推移增加成本。
改进的电子邮件响应:当您手动整理垃圾邮件时,对合法查询的响应时间可能会增加。这会对您的业务产生不利影响。但如果它已经排序,您的响应时间就会很快。
防范恶意软件:提交的垃圾邮件可能带有有害链接或文件附件,可能会影响您网站的安全。它还可以窃取您用户的数据。因此,需要垃圾邮件防护。
维护信任和安全:受垃圾邮件保护的表单让用户在填写时感到安全。此外,他们会知道他们的询问将得到认真对待并得到答复。
减少管理负担:手动筛选条目需要花费大量工时。您可能只需要雇用专门的人员来完成这项任务。
现在您已经了解了防止联系表单垃圾邮件的重要性,让我们看看实现它的各种方法。
阻止 WordPress 中的联系表单垃圾邮件的 6 种方法
1. 反垃圾邮件插件
当涉及 WordPress 网站管理的任何方面时,WordPress 插件都是全能解决方案。使用反垃圾邮件插件是保存联系表单的最简单也是最有效的方法之一。这些插件经过训练可以过滤常见模式以阻止垃圾邮件源。现在,这些插件会定期更新,以了解新的垃圾邮件技术并防止它们。
Akismet、Antispam Bee、WPBruiser 和 Spam Destroyer 等插件非常流行,可以从 WordPress.org 免费下载。这些插件是轻量级的,可以有效地阻止垃圾邮件。
这些插件易于设置,无需任何编码知识即可配置。这是在没有验证码的情况下防止联系表单垃圾邮件的理想方法。
2. 添加谷歌验证码
我们所有人都多次遇到过 Google reCAPTCHA 和“确认您是人类”。同样,您可以为 WordPress 启用 reCAPTCHA。通常,它会给识别图像或选中复选框带来挑战。该算法经过相应的训练,可以理解并防止机器人向您的网站提交联系表单垃圾邮件。
目前,reCAPTCHA 有两个主要版本。它们是 reCAPTCHA v2 和 v3。
v2版本为用户提供了选择特定图像的任务。它们的设计方式使得机器人无法轻易绕过。
v3 是一个不可见的 reCAPTCHA 版本。图像或复选框对某些人来说可能看起来很突兀,这就是 V3 的原因。它在后台运行并跟踪用户行为。由此,它可以确定它是机器人还是人类。
将 Google reCAPTCHA 与您的 WordPress 网站集成起来相当容易。借助 ARForms,您可以启用 reCAPTCHA 以实现动态表单安全。
3. 蜜罐技术
蜜罐技术是添加垃圾邮件防护的最令人印象深刻的方法之一。这是一种用户友好的方法,不会中断用户与表单的交互。您可以使用 CSS 或 HTML 手动设置,或使用提供蜜罐反垃圾邮件功能的插件。但它实际上是如何运作的呢?
- 好吧,您创建一个表单字段并将其隐藏
- 这个字段对于人类用户来说是不可见的,但是机器人就是机器人,会不加区别地填写所有字段
- 因此,您的条件是,如果该字段已填满,则它是机器人条目,如果为空,则它是人类条目。
手动实现代码
创建隐藏字段:
<input type="text" name="hidden_field" />
对于设置举报垃圾邮件的条件(如果满足):
if (!empty($_POST['hidden_field'])) {
// Flag as spam and prevent form submission
}
4. JavaScript 令牌方法
此方法还提供无形的垃圾邮件防护并增加了一层安全性。每个填写表单的真实用户都会获得一个唯一的一次性令牌。该令牌由 JavaScript 生成。该令牌是提交表单所必需的。现在,机器人不具备 JavaScript 功能,因此无法生成这些令牌。没有令牌,没有表单提交。
通过这种方法,用户体验不会受到任何影响。这是与其他一些垃圾邮件防护方法的强大补充方法。因此,您可以轻松地设置分层安全。
唯一的缺点是技术设置。如果您是编码员或开发人员,那么这很容易。但对于其他人来说,这可能是一件令人头疼的事情。但是,如果您有技术支持,则必须考虑它是一个可靠的安全层。
5. 使用防火墙或安全插件
WordPress 防火墙甚至可以在垃圾邮件到达您的网站之前就成为强大的 WordPress 垃圾邮件拦截器。他们接受过培训,可以监控所有流量并阻止所有可疑行为模式。 Wordfence、Defender Pro、Sucuri 和 BulletProof 是著名的防火墙插件。这些插件足够先进,可以阻止垃圾邮件并保护您的网站免受黑客攻击。它还可以保护您免受恶意软件或任何 DDoS 攻击。
防火墙足够强大,可以阻止可疑的 IP 地址、国家或具有类似垃圾邮件行为的用户。这在服务器级别起作用,因此机器人甚至无法到达您的表单。
多个 WordPress 安全插件提供垃圾邮件防护、防火墙、恶意软件和黑客防护等功能。其中最著名的是 Jetpack、Wordfence Security 和 Security Optimizer。
6. 使用 ARForms 进行内置垃圾邮件防护
借助 ARForms,您可以获得内置的反垃圾邮件和 reCAPTCHA 支持。因此,在构建多种形式的同时,您还可以关注安全性。您不需要 Google reCAPTCHA 或任何其他带有 ARForms 的外部插件。
此外,您还可以获得带有 ARForms 的 Google reCAPTCHA 免费附加组件,以保护您的网站免受垃圾邮件和滥用行为的侵害。它具有简单的界面并提供跨浏览器支持。它的过程非常简单,您需要添加 API 密钥来激活它。
借助 ARForms,您可以获得 Google reCAPTCHA 和 Cloudflare Turnstile CAPTCHA 的内置功能。避免使用多个插件来处理垃圾邮件和安全问题,并从单个插件中获取解决方案。
结束联系表单垃圾邮件方法
阻止联系表单垃圾邮件的方法多种多样。您可以选择一种或使用多种方法设置多步骤安全性。如果您经常创建多个表单,那么选择 ARForms 反垃圾邮件插件是最佳选择。它将为您提供强大的功能,如条件逻辑、数学逻辑、内置模板、地图集成、在线支付等等!它是一个全能的表单插件,具有免费的精简版本,具有强大的反垃圾邮件功能。
您准备好保护您的表单免受机器人攻击并提高您的效率了吗?选择一种方法,让我们的读者知道哪种方法最适合您。
联系表垃圾邮件防护常见问题解答
1. 我可以选择哪些插件来实施蜜罐技术?
HoneyPot for Contact Form 7、WP Armour、Honeypot Anti-spam、Honeypot for WP Comment 和 F12 垃圾邮件防护是一些可以帮助您设置 Honeypot 垃圾邮件防护的插件。2. 谷歌验证码可以非侵入式吗?
Google reCAPTCHA 的 V3 在后台运行并且不可见。因此,它是非侵入式的,可以帮助您设置无缝的用户体验。3. 什么是多层垃圾邮件防护系统?以及如何实施它们?
多层垃圾邮件防护系统意味着为您的网站使用不止一种垃圾邮件防护或安全措施。您可以将 Google reCAPTCHA 作为您的基本垃圾邮件功能以及防火墙、安全插件或蜜罐。这样就可以轻松实现多层保护。另请阅读这些:
- 您必须看到的最佳联系我们页面示例
- 办公室因假期而关闭消息示例